Definition Rails are the members of the track laid in two parallel lines to provide an unchanging, continuous, and level surface for the movement of trains. The rail is a steel girder carrying the axle load of the train. In the world there are mainly three types of rail tracks, normal rail track, high speed rail track and subway track. Types of Rails Double Headed Rail Originally the rails used were double-headed made of I section or Dumbbell section as shown in the figure. Supported joint In this type of joint, the ends of the rails are supported directly on the sleeper. Broad-gauge railways are standard in Russia, Finland, Ireland, India, Sri Lanka, Pakistan, Nepal, Bangladesh, Portugal, and Spain. What is Wear of Rail The separation or cutting of rail due to friction and abnormal heavy load is called wear.
